7.2 Multiple CPRI client signal mapping using GFP-T
Transparent generic framing procedure (GFP-T), as defined in clause 8 of [ITU-T G.7041], can be used to
carry CPRI clients. The GFP multiplexing facility described in clause 6.1.2.1.3.2 of [ITU-T G.7041] provides a
means to carry multiple CPRI clients of the same rate within an OPUk or an OPUflex(GFP) carrier. These two
facilities can be combined to yield a method to map multiple CPRI clients (Options 1 to 6) into an ODU2
carrier stream as per clause 17.4 of [ITU-T G.709]. The CPRI clients being mapped are synchronous to each
other. The ODU2/OTU2 clock is made to be synchronous to the CPRI clients. The selection of which CPRI
client provides a reference clock to the OTU2 clock is outside the scope of this document. Figure 7-1 shows
the mapping of ynchronous CPRI clients into a synchronous OTU2.
Figure 7-1 – Mapping of synchronous CPRI clients into a synchronous OTU2
The relationship between the OTU2 bit rate and the CPRI client bit rate is given by:
CPRI_BitRate = k * OTU2_BitRate * (79/1377)
The value of the scaler 'k' for CPRI options 1 to 6 are shown in Table 7-10.
Table 7-10 – Scaler 'k' of CRPI options 1 to 6
CPRI client k
Option 1 (614.4 Mbps) 1
Option 2 (1228.8 Mbps) 2
Option 3 (2457.6 Mbps) 4
Option 4 (3072.0 Mbps) 5
Option 5 (4915.2 Mbps) 8
Option 6 (6144.0 Mbps) 10
